Crazy_Boot is a virus that causes no intentional, permanent damage. However, if the host computer is booted from an infected floppy disk, Crazy_Boot makes it appear that all physical hard drives have been lost. Crazy_Boot spreads to unprotected disks easily. It spreads only on diskettes, not by file distribution.
